From Glasgow, Scotland, The Hermit Crabs are John Ferguson (lead guitar), Melanie Whittle (guitar and vocals), Tony McDonald (drums), Mark Waudby (bass guitar), and Ali King (violin, keyboards, percussion). Melanie Whittle formed the band in January 2003 after another band that she was playing drums in was put on hold. Their first gig was at Tchai-Ovna Teahouse in the west end of Glasgow. Melanie Whittle is the sole permanent member. Current members John Ferguson joined the band in late 2004 on lead guitar and Tony McDonald joined on drums in August 2006. In 2005, Whittle was a winner of the Burnsong national songwriting competition with a song called Feel Good Factor, and in January 2007 it became the title track of their debut release, a 4 track EP on Matinee Recordings. In October 2007 Matinee released their first album, 'Saw You Dancing.'
